def delete(args):
pasteid = args.paste
token = args.token
if args.debug: print("PasteID:\t{}\nToken:\t\t{}".format(pasteid, token))
result = privatebin().delete(pasteid, token)
if args.debug: print("Response:\t{}\n".format(result.decode("UTF-8")))
try:
result = json.loads(result)
except ValueError as e:
print("PBinCLI Error: {}".format(e))
sys.exit(1)
if 'status' in result and not result['status']:
print("Paste successfully deleted!")
elif 'status' in result and result['status']:
print("Something went wrong...\nError:\t\t{}".format(result['message']))
sys.exit(1)
